Intelligent Anti-fraud Software Market - Global Forecast 2026-2032

The Intelligent Anti-fraud Software Market size was estimated at USD 13.34 billion in 2025 and expected to reach USD 14.29 billion in 2026, at a CAGR of 6.86% to reach USD 21.24 billion by 2032.

Navigating the Paradigm Shift in Fraud Prevention: How AI, Machine Learning, Behavioral Analytics, and Real-Time Intelligence Are Redefining Security

The landscape of fraud prevention has undergone a profound metamorphosis driven by rapid advancements in artificial intelligence, machine learning, and real‐time behavioral analytics. In recent years, the integration of deep learning models and graph analytics has enabled platforms to identify subtle anomalies across vast transaction streams, transforming reactive investigations into proactive interdictions. As a result, organizations are now equipped to counter emerging threats such as application manipulation and identity spoofing before they materialize into financial loss.

Moreover, the advent of adaptive orchestration layers has facilitated seamless interoperability between fraud systems, identity verification services, and compliance engines, fostering ecosystems that continuously learn and self‐optimize. These capabilities not only reduce false positives but also streamline customer journeys by minimizing friction. In parallel, the rise of federated learning approaches addresses data privacy concerns by enabling institutions to collaboratively train models without exchanging sensitive raw data. Together, these technological breakthroughs are redefining what it means to secure digital transactions, elevating fraud prevention from static defense to an evolving, intelligence‐driven discipline.

Assessing the Ripple Effects of United States 2025 Tariff Policies on Cross-Border Fraud Risks, Compliance Challenges, and Software Innovation Dynamics

In 2025, newly implemented United States tariffs targeting semiconductor imports, cloud infrastructure components, and security hardware have introduced novel complexities for anti‐fraud software providers. Increased costs for advanced chips used in edge‐AI modules have squeezed hardware margins, compelling vendors to reassess their cost structures and consider software‐centric delivery and accelerated subscription models. Additionally, levies on cloud service operations have exerted upward pressure on deployment expenses, particularly for solutions leveraging high‐throughput GPU clusters in public cloud environments.

These fiscal pressures have also had a downstream effect on compliance strategies, as organizations seek to reconcile trade regulations with data residency requirements and export controls. Consequently, some enterprises have optimized their deployment mix by shifting workloads to hybrid cloud models or localized private data centers to maintain performance benchmarks without incurring prohibitive tariffs. In response, vendors have intensified partnerships with domestic infrastructure providers and pursued containerized delivery options to mitigate tariff pass‐through, thereby safeguarding both operational continuity and regulatory alignment.

Unlocking Deep Insights Through Segmented Analysis of End Users, Deployment Models, Components, and Fraud Types to Drive Targeted Strategies

A nuanced understanding of the market emerges when viewing anti‐fraud adoption through multiple segmentation lenses. When dissecting end‐user industries, the financial sector continues to lead demand, driven by stringent regulatory obligations and high transaction volumes, while government agencies prioritize identity verification and citizen data protection. Healthcare stakeholders are increasingly integrating fraud analytics to safeguard patient information and billing integrity, even as retail and e‐commerce platforms fortify payment gateways. Meanwhile, telecom and IT operators focus on network integrity and subscriber fraud prevention to sustain service reliability.

Transitioning to deployment preferences reveals a pronounced shift toward cloud delivery, with enterprises embracing hybrid cloud architectures to balance scalability and data sovereignty. Within public cloud environments, hyperscale providers are collaborating directly with anti‐fraud vendors to offer pre‐integrated solutions, while private cloud options cater to organizations with elevated compliance mandates. On‐premises installations remain relevant for legacy systems and highly regulated sectors that require full infrastructure control.

From a component standpoint, solution licenses form the core of market offerings, complemented by managed and professional services that expedite implementation, customization, and ongoing optimization. This blended service model allows organizations to leverage vendor expertise for continuous threat intelligence updates and rule‐set tuning. Finally, analyzing fraud types highlights distinct risk areas: account takeover and identity fraud spur investments in multifactor authentication and biometric verification; application fraud necessitates runtime monitoring; and payment fraud-spanning both card‐present and card‐not‐present scenarios-drives omnichannel transaction monitoring solutions.

Comparative Regional Dynamics in Fraud Prevention Adoption Across the Americas Europe Middle East Africa and Asia-Pacific Markets

Regional dynamics play a pivotal role in shaping anti‐fraud strategies, as each geography contends with its own regulatory landscape, fraud typologies, and technology adoption behaviors. In the Americas, the confluence of mature financial markets and progressive data privacy regulations has accelerated adoption of AI‐driven fraud suites, particularly among banking institutions and digital wallets. Cross‐border payment volumes have spurred innovative consortia that share anonymized threat intelligence to preempt emerging scams.

Across Europe, the Middle East, and Africa, regulatory frameworks such as PSD2 have catalyzed open banking initiatives, necessitating robust authentication measures and real‐time transaction scoring. Meanwhile, rapid e‐commerce growth in emerging EMEA markets has elevated payment fraud concerns, prompting regional players to integrate multi‐layered verification checkpoints that align with mobile wallet proliferation.

In the Asia‐Pacific region, high mobile penetration and a diverse fintech ecosystem have created fertile ground for biometric authentication, behavioral biometrics, and voice verification solutions. Governments in the region are actively sponsoring national digital identity programs, which, when paired with intelligent fraud analytics, enhance predictive capabilities and foster public‐private collaboration. Collectively, these regional nuances underscore the importance of tailoring anti‐fraud deployments to local market intricacies.

Profiling Leading Innovators and Market Pacesetters Shaping the Future of Anti-Fraud Software Solutions

The competitive landscape is characterized by a mix of established technology giants, specialized security vendors, and innovative startups, each vying to deliver differentiated value propositions. Leading providers leverage advanced neural network architectures and proprietary threat intelligence feeds to achieve sub‐second fraud detection and automated remediation workflows. These incumbents often maintain global threat research labs that continuously analyze intrusion attempts and feed insights back into their detection engines.

Concurrently, a wave of nimble challengers is carving out niches by focusing on specific fraud vectors or vertical industry requirements. Some vendors differentiate through turnkey professional services that accelerate time‐to‐value, while others emphasize open application programming interfaces and modular frameworks that seamlessly integrate with existing risk management platforms. Strategic partnerships between security firms, cloud hyperscalers, and telco operators further shape the vendor ecosystem, enabling co‐innovated solutions that address region‐specific payment channels and regulatory stipulations.

Moreover, mergers and acquisitions continue to realign competitive positions, as larger players acquire algorithm-centric startups to bolster their AI capabilities and expand into adjacent fraud domains. This dynamic environment underscores the importance of continual portfolio evaluation to ensure alignment with both organizational risk appetites and technological roadmaps.

Strategic Imperatives for Industry Leaders to Enhance Resilience Drive Adoption and Optimize Fraud Prevention Frameworks

Industry leaders must embrace a multi‐pronged approach to fortify defenses and maximize return on anti‐fraud investments. First, organizations should establish a continuous intelligence feedback loop by integrating internal transaction data with external threat feeds and dark web monitoring outcomes. This convergence of data sources enables adaptive model training and rapid incorporation of emerging fraud patterns.

Simultaneously, governance frameworks must be updated to reflect the shift from static rule sets to dynamic risk scoring, ensuring that cross‐functional teams can respond swiftly to system‐generated alerts and automated case assignments. Embedding continuous testing and scenario simulation into operational workflows will enable organizations to stress‐test their defenses against new attack vectors before they materialize.

Furthermore, executives should allocate resources toward staff skill development, emphasizing data science competencies and fraud analytics expertise, while fostering a culture of interdisciplinary collaboration between risk, IT, and business units. Lastly, forging strategic alliances with specialized vendors and consortiums will facilitate threat intelligence sharing, joint research initiatives, and co‐development of cutting‐edge countermeasures-all of which serve to elevate organizational resilience against sophisticated fraud campaigns.
